REMIXED CHAMPAGNE KIRS
Steps:
- MARINATED RASPBERRIES: In a medium sized bowl combine the vodka, sugar, Thai chile, and peppercorns, and mix. Add the fresh raspberries and vanilla bean pod, and stir carefully so all the raspberries are covered in vodka marinade. Cover and refrigerate for 3 hours or overnight.
- SHKIAFFING IT TOGETHER: Add 3 marinated raspberries to the bottom of each champagne glass. Pour chilled champagne over the top.
KIR ROYALE
Make a classic kir royale cocktail with crème de cassis (blackcurrant liqueur) and your favourite champagne. Garnish with a blackberry to serve to guests

Steps:
- Pour the crème de cassis into the bottom of a champagne flute.
- Top with chilled champagne and garnish with the fresh or frozen blackberry.

THE STEP-BY-STEP GUIDE TO BUILDING A CHAMPAGNE TOWER

- Procure Champagne Coupes. As much as we love a beautiful Champagne flute and even just plain old white wine glasses, neither should be used in the construction of your tower.
- Find A Sturdy Base. We can’t stress this enough, the base of your tower needs to be sturdy. We like to use a large coffee table, or a dining room table for the job.
- Start Constructing Your Tower, Starting With The First Level. The tower is built by creating squares that get successively smaller as the tower rises.
- The Glasses Must Touch. As you build the tower make sure each glass is snuggly touching the other glasses. If you do this correctly, four glasses touching will create a diamond shape in the middle.
- Build Your Next Level. After you’ve constructed your first level, move on to the second. Place the center of each glass’s stem directly in the center of the diamonds created by the touching glasses on the lower level.
- Continue Building Until You Reach The Top. When your tower is completed you should have several layers of successive touching glasses, with every layer above placed in the center of the diamond created by the glasses, with one solitary glass sitting at the top.
- Procure Really Good Champagne. Sure, Prosecco, Cava and even sparkling Cider will work here, but you went to the trouble of building the tower in the first place, so why scrimp now?
- Pop Open – Or Saber – Your Champagne And Start Filling. This part takes a ton of patience, but when done right, it looks super cool. Slowly begin pouring the chilled Champagne into the glass at the top of the tower, allowing the Champagne to overflow.
